The ingredients needed to make Heath Bits Peanut Butter Cookies:
  1. Take 1/2 cup shortening
  2. Get 3/4 cup creamy peanut butter
  3. Get 1 1/4 cup light brown sugar
  4. Get 3 tbsp milk
  5. Prepare 1 tbsp vanilla extract
  6. Make ready 1 eggs
  7. Prepare 1 1/2 cup all purpose flour
  8. Get 3/4 tsp baking soda
  9. Make ready 3/4 tbsp salt
  10. Make ready 1 packages 8oz heath toffee bits
  11. Get 1 cookie sheet
Instructions to make Heath Bits Peanut Butter Cookies:
  1. Heat oven 375°
  2. Beat shortening, peanut butter, brown sugar, milk and vanilla in large bowl until Well blended. Add egg beat until blended.
  3. Combine flour, baking soda, and salt gradually beat into peanut butter mixture. Stir in 1 cup toffee bits reserve remainder for topping.
  4. Drop by heaping teaspoons about 2 inches apart onto ungreased cookie sheet top each with reserved toffee bits. Bake 7 to 8 minutes or until set. Cool 2 minutes remove to wire rack. Makes about 3 dozen.
